If you buy LSR buy the billet instead of the cast. The billet is a lot stronger. I just bought a carrier off of ebay for $135 with the bearings and center tube included. I am impressed with the quality and it has the zerk on the outside so you don't have to pull it apart to grease it. It did tend to pop grease out on the left bearing before it hit the other bearing while packing the carrier with grease. It's not a big deal, just grease it real good again after your first ride. Still, a nice carrier for the dough. :p
